How much is the rebate for solar panels in Mannus, NSW

The Australian Federal Government has incentives for Mannus homeowners to install solar. They give "STCs" (small-scale technology certificates) to people who add a solar power system to their home.

The government divides the country into "Zones" depending on the rated solar potential. You get more support or less depending on your zone. Mannus is in Climate Zone 3 which has a rating of 1.382.

This means a 10 kW solar system installed in Mannus during 2024 would give you 96 ST Certificates worth $3830.40 (at an STC price of $39.90 each).

If you wait until 2025 for your panels the rebate in Mannus will be reduced. It goes down every year.

Here's about how much Solar Energy falls on Mannus by month. The maximum is 7.03 kWh/M2 in January. The minimum is 1.84 kWh/M2 during June.

Daily Energy Per Square Metre in Mannus
MonthEnergy MJ/M2kWh/M2
Jan25.327.03
Feb21.636.01
Mar17.914.97
Apr12.773.55
May8.712.42
Jun6.631.84
Jul6.971.94
Aug9.542.65
Sep14.073.91
Oct19.695.47
Nov22.376.21
Dec25.227.01

Figures from the weather station at Cabramurra, which is approximately 42.9 km from Mannus.

Mannus, NSW is in the 2653 postcode area which has around 415 solar installations under 10 kW and about 442 total installations including large scale solar. In comparison there are about 105107 small solar installations in the Gold Coast region.

With an estimated 1173 households in the 2653 area that gives a small solar installation (average size around 4.36 kW) for about every 2.8 dwellings.

Solar Panel Angle in Mannus

It is generally recommended to angle your panels at about 35.8° from the horizontal in this area - facing north, although your power usage patterns could alter this - if you are out all day.
